Cesium-137 and its decay product, barium-137m, are used for sterilization activities for food products, including wheat, spices, flour, and potatoes. Cesium-137 is also used in a wide variety of industrial instruments such as level and thickness gauges and moisture density gauges. Cesium-137 is also commonly used in hospitals for

3.10 Laboratory Fortified Sample Matrix (LFM) - An aliquot of an environmental sample to which known quantities of the method analytes are added in the laboratory. The LFM is analyzed exactly like a sample, and its purpose is to determine whether the sample matrix contributes bias to the analytical results.

Barium found in Manitoba well water usually occurs naturally. It is the result of groundwater coming into contact with bedrock or minerals containing barium. The concentration of barium in well water depends on a number of factors such as the amount of barium present in the rock or soil through which the groundwater has

The presence of gypsum limits dispersion of soil colloids. In the traditional procedures for particle-size analysis of gypsiferous soils, gypsum present in small amounts is leached by using distilled water (Baldwin et al. 1938, Barzanji 1973). Solutions of strong electrolytes can be used to increase the solubility of gypsum and shorten the leaching time (Abrukova and Isayev …

Barium slag is a kind of solid waste derived from the carbon reduction process of producing barium salt. Carbon is one of the main components in barium slag with a content of more than 10%. In this study, a barium slag was characterized using XRF, XRD and SEM-EDS, and froth flotation test was introduced to recover the carbon in the barium slag.
